Brief Explanations
- HL (Hypotenuse - Leg): If the hypotenuse and a leg of one right - triangle are congruent to the hypotenuse and a leg of another right - triangle, the triangles are congruent. In right - triangles \(\triangle CDE\) and \(\triangle OPQ\), if we assume the marked segments (one leg and the hypotenuse) are congruent (from the diagram's markings), HL can be used.
- LA (Leg - Angle): If a leg and an acute angle of one right - triangle are congruent to the corresponding leg and acute angle of another right - triangle, the triangles are congruent. Here, we have a right angle (\(90^{\circ}\)), a leg (marked in the diagram), and an acute angle (marked in the diagram) for both triangles.
- AAS (Angle - Angle - Side): If two angles and a non - included side of one triangle are congruent to two angles and the corresponding non - included side of another triangle, the triangles are congruent. We have two angles (right angle and the marked acute angle) and a side (marked leg) for both triangles.
